Posted by: Mr. Babatunde« on: October 24, 2018, 12:46:37 PM »Ex Governor of Ekiti State Ayodele Fayose was arraigned before Justice Mojisola Olatoregun by the Economic and Financial Crimes Commission (EFCC) on charges of corruption. He arrived at the court premises on Wednesday around 9am, escorted by armed security operatives and officials of the commission. The Federal High Court sitting in Ikoyi, Lagos, on Wednesday has granted the Ex Governor of Ekiti State Ayodele Fayose bail in the sum of N50m. The session on Wednesday, which is his second appearance before the court, lasted less than 30 minutes. The court also asked Fayose to provide a surety, who must have landed property in Lagos. The guarantor is also required to have three-year tax clearance in Lagos. Fayose, who only left office last week, is facing an 11-count charge bothering on receiving illegal monies to fund his 2014 governorship campaign in Ekiti State, among other allegations of benefiting from proceeds of money laundering.
